Default Re: JTs on button, crazy river action.

PREFLOP: I dont think it matters in the long run whether you call or raise in this spot.

FLOP: I like your check. You are against 4 players, a flop bet will never win this pot, and you could get checkraised and have to pay 2sbs to see the turn when you couldve done that for free. If however all you opponents are passive and very unlikely to checkraise you, betting the flop may be ok with the intention of taking a free card on the next round. But with no read and no hand against 4 opponents, I think the standard line should be to take your free card right away on the flop.

Turn: Standard

River: Good fold, given the action and the description of the players, there is no way your hand is good.
